What is a Category C-E Driving License?
In Poland, a Category C-E driving license allows individuals to drive big automobiles with a weight going beyond 3.5 loads and also tow an articulated trailer. This category is important for professionals in transportation and logistics sectors, as it is important for providing items across the nation and beyond.

Before embarking on the journey to get a Category C-E driving license, candidates should ensure they satisfy the following eligibility criteria:
Minimum Age: The minimum age to make an application for a Category C-E license is 21 years.Previous License: Applicants need to have a legitimate Category B license and, for the most part, a Category C license as well.Medical exam: Candidates must go through a medical assessment to confirm their physical fitness to drive heavy lorries.Mental Assessment: A mental examination is also needed to make sure candidates can handle the stress and duty associated with operating large vehicles.Actions to Obtain a Category C-E License1. Complete Medical and Psychological Assessments
Before beginning the application process, candidates should arrange and finish both medical and mental evaluations. These assessments ensure that they are physically and mentally healthy to operate heavy automobiles.
2. Enroll in a Driving School
As soon as the evaluations are complete, the next step is to enlist in a licensed driving school. The driving school should offer specific training for the Category C-E license. The course generally includes both theoretical and useful training.
3. Total Theoretical Training
The theoretical training includes a range of subjects such as:
Basics of driving big automobilesTraffic policies particular to heavy automobilesSecurity procedures and threat awarenessLoading and protecting cargo4. Pass Theoretical Exam
After completing the theoretical part of the training, prospects need to pass a theoretical exam that assesses their knowledge of all the topics covered. This exam usually includes multiple-choice concerns.
5. Complete Practical Training and Driving Hours
Following the theoretical assessment, prospects will undergo useful training with an instructor. This portion of the training should cover driving in various scenarios, such as:
Urban drivingHighway drivingSteering with a trailerManaging emergency circumstances6. Pass Practical Exam
Upon finishing the needed driving hours, prospects will be evaluated in a practical exam to demonstrate their driving abilities with a Category C-E automobile and trailer.
7. Submit Application to the Local Authority
Once both the theoretical and useful tests have been effectively passed, prospects can submit their application to the local authority (Starostwo Powiatowe). This application must consist of:
Medical and psychological assessment resultsDriving school certificateEvidence of passing theoretical and practical examsA legitimate recognition document (e.g., passport, ID card)8. Get the License
After sending the application, prospects may need to pay a charge to receive their brand-new driving license. If everything remains in order, the local authority will release the Category C-E driving license.

Yes, immigrants might look for a Category C-E license in Poland, provided they meet the fundamental eligibility requirements consisting of the proper documents that confirms their existing licenses and medical evaluations in accordance with Polish guidelines.
3. What is the cost of getting a Category C-E license?
The cost can differ depending on the driving school and extra costs connected to the theoretical and useful exams. On average, applicants ought to spending plan in between 3,000 to 6,000 PLN (approximately 600 to 1,200 EUR).
4. Exists a difference in between Category C and C-E licenses?
Yes, Prawo Jazdy a Category C license permits you to drive heavy automobiles (over 3.5 tons) without a trailer, while a Category C-E license allows you to tow a trailer that surpasses 750 kg when driving a heavy vehicle.
